(PIII) reported a first-quarter 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$0.32, a substantial beat against the consensus estimate of -$3.5751, representing a positive surprise of 108.95%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the initial release. Despite the earnings upside, the stock declined by 4.76%, suggesting market skepticism regarding the sustainability of the profitability shift.

The company reported a notable reduction in medical cost ratios as care management initiatives took effect, contributing to a positive net income for the first time in several quarters. While total revenue was not formally reported, executives indicated that membership growth and stabilization of utilization trends supported the earnings rebound. Segment‑level improvements in care coordination and lower administrative expenses were cited as key pillars of the margin expansion. Management also noted ongoing investments in data analytics to better manage patient risk scores, which may further enhance profitability. However, they acknowledged that the quarter’s results included one‑time benefits from favorable prior‑period claim developments, and underlying operational leverage remains a work in progress.

However, management expressed cautious optimism that the quarterly profitability achieved in Q1 could be replicated if membership trends remain stable and medical cost ratios stay within target ranges. Strategic priorities include expanding into new geographic markets, deepening partnerships with health plans, and scaling value‑based care contracts. The company expects to continue investing in technology and care coordination capabilities, which may pressure near‑term margins but could drive long‑term growth. Risk factors include potential volatility in utilization patterns, regulatory changes in Medicare reimbursement, and the challenge of maintaining the improved cost structure. The surprise EPS beat may set a higher bar for future quarters, and management acknowledged the need to demonstrate consistent operating discipline to reassure investors.

Analysts suggested that the market may be discounting the one‑time nature of certain gains and the lack of revenue disclosure, which tempers the positive earnings surprise. Some analysts noted that while the $0.32 EPS is encouraging, the company’s historical volatility in profitability makes it difficult to extrapolate this quarter’s performance. Investor attention is likely to focus on upcoming quarters for evidence of sustained operational improvements, particularly regarding medical cost trends and membership retention. The absence of revenue data leaves a gap in assessing top‑line health. Key watchpoints include any changes to guidance, disclosure of revenue metrics in subsequent filings, and commentary on the competitive landscape in the Medicare Advantage market.
